Output 51df29223fc5e310000145d4f122d4fd389da431533a2fe23d5b21b060f9f7c1:0

value
62466500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91a246b2d97a38f78fa2c6866a2ae6f64349253e OP_EQUAL
address
MMBCcPee4BA5fQ5CJHVkz6vTELEo3a4keH
transaction
51df29223fc5e310000145d4f122d4fd389da431533a2fe23d5b21b060f9f7c1
spent
true